| Hi all
My camellias are in bud but haven't come out yet how long does it usually take from bud to bloom?
Jan |

| I only have experience with japonicas but flower formation is a fairly relaxed process. Haven't actually timed them but around 6 to 8 weeks I think. You can tell they are getting serious about flowering when a little bit of colour shows at the end of the bud. I have a number of shrubs. Bud formation is in different stages from very small to quite round and fat. They will come into bloom from around mid-winter to late spring, depending on the variety. |

It seems to me the position in the garden has something to do with the length of time. I have found they vary from shrub to shrub. Cheers, Dee. |
